Description

The 6th Sense Lure Lab, in collaboration with trophy bass angler Josh Jones, set out to create a unique presentation to entice those high-pressured fish. After over a year of testing and tweaking, we're excited to introduce the Flock Hair Jig. Josh has landed multiple double-digit bass with this jig, praising its lifelike imitation that fish haven't encountered before. This jig features a blend of shimmering holographic tinsel, resilient buck tail hair, delicate feathers, supple silicon skirts, and slender tinsel, offering unparalleled versatility. Its distinctive 3D head shape paired with a robust hook distinguishes it as a truly unique offering. Available in four sizes, ranging from 5/16oz to 3/4oz, it allows anglers to explore various depths with ease. The Flock Hair Jig has proven its worth by contributing to numerous double-digit catches across the nation, earning it an essential spot in any angler's tackle box.

Field Notes

Use this hair jig when bass are pressured and responding to a more natural, subtle presentation. It’s a good choice for casting around cover or open water and letting the jig swim or fall through the strike zone. The lifelike hair, tinsel, and feather mix is designed to imitate small baitfish and trigger bites from wary fish.

Pros

  • Lifelike profile and subtle action
  • Good for pressured bass
  • Available in multiple weights for different depths

Cons

  • May be less effective in heavy vegetation than bulkier jigs
  • Subtle presentation can be harder to fish in dirty water
